Japan's Wartime Strategies in WWII

This chapter examines the various strategies Japan contemplated during World War II, including territorial expansion and reliance on Axis victories. It highlights the cultural ideologies influencing Japanese military actions and reflects on the complex motivations behind wartime decisions. Additionally, the chapter explores the logistical challenges faced during the Pacific theater, showcasing the unique environmental and strategic obstacles that shaped military outcomes.
